How does the curves behave to the detail in the image in isopreference curve?


  1. Curves tend to become more vertical as the detail in the image decreases
  2. Curves tend to become less vertical as the detail in the image increases
  3. Curves tend to become less vertical as the detail in the image decreases
  4. Curves tend to become more vertical as the detail in the image increases
